How Cooking Changes Carrot Nutrients
Carrots contain several important compounds: beta-carotene, vitamin C, fiber, potassium, and polyphenols. Each reacts differently to heat:
- Beta-Carotene: This fat-soluble antioxidant becomes more bioavailable after cooking because heat breaks down the plant’s cell walls.
- Vitamin C: Sensitive to heat and water; cooking reduces its content significantly.
- Fiber: Cooking softens fiber but doesn’t remove it; however, raw carrots offer a firmer texture that promotes digestive health.
- Polyphenols: Some degrade with heat; others become easier to absorb.
So, both raw and cooked carrots have their perks depending on what you’re after nutritionally.
The Science Behind Beta-Carotene Absorption
Beta-carotene is the superstar nutrient in carrots. It converts into vitamin A in the body — essential for eye health, skin integrity, and immune defense. However, beta-carotene is locked inside carrot cells.
Cooking disrupts these cell walls. Research shows that boiling or steaming carrots can increase beta-carotene absorption by up to 14%, while raw carrots provide less bioavailable beta-carotene.
Interestingly, pairing cooked carrots with a little fat (like olive oil or butter) further boosts absorption since beta-carotene dissolves in fat.
Vitamin C: The Heat-Sensitive Nutrient
Vitamin C is water-soluble and highly sensitive to heat. Raw carrots contain about 7 mg of vitamin C per 100 grams. Boiling or steaming can reduce this by up to 50% or more depending on cooking time.
If you want to maximize vitamin C intake from carrots, eating them raw or lightly steaming is best. Vitamin C supports immune function and skin health but is not as abundant in carrots compared to other vegetables like bell peppers or citrus fruits.
The Role of Fiber in Raw vs Cooked Carrots
Fiber is a vital component for digestive health. Raw carrots provide insoluble fiber that adds bulk to stool and supports gut motility. When cooked, some of this fiber softens but remains intact enough to aid digestion.
The crunchiness of raw carrots also encourages chewing which stimulates saliva production—aiding digestion from the start.
Both forms promote satiety but raw carrots might feel more filling due to their texture.
A Closer Look at Polyphenols and Antioxidants
Polyphenols contribute antioxidant benefits that protect cells from damage. Some studies suggest mild cooking can increase certain polyphenol levels by freeing them from plant matrices; however, excessive heat reduces overall antioxidant activity.
Steaming tends to preserve these compounds better than boiling or frying.

The Impact of Cooking Methods on Carrot Nutrition
Not all cooking methods are created equal when it comes to preserving carrot nutrients:
- Steaming: Retains most nutrients including beta-carotene; minimal nutrient loss.
- Boiling: Causes leaching of water-soluble vitamins like vitamin C into cooking water.
- Baking/Roasting: Enhances flavor but may reduce some heat-sensitive vitamins.
- Sautéing: Preserves beta-carotene well if done quickly with oil.
Steaming is often recommended for maximizing nutrient retention while softening texture enough for better digestion.
The Role of Fat in Cooking Carrots
Since beta-carotene is fat-soluble, adding healthy fats during cooking improves its absorption dramatically. A splash of olive oil or a knob of butter not only enriches flavor but unlocks more nutritional benefits than eating plain cooked carrots alone.
This simple addition turns cooked carrots into a nutrient-dense side dish that supports eye health effectively.
The Digestive Benefits of Raw vs Cooked Carrots
Raw carrots provide bulk through insoluble fiber that helps move food through the digestive tract efficiently. Their crunchy texture stimulates chewing which triggers digestive enzymes early on.
Cooked carrots’ softened fibers are easier on sensitive stomachs or those with digestive issues like irritable bowel syndrome (IBS). They still promote gut health but with less mechanical effort required during digestion.
Depending on your digestive needs or preferences, you might favor one form over the other for comfort or effectiveness.
